From Ground: First, water the shaggy leaf fig plant to dampen the soil. Then, dig a wide trench around the plant using a shovel or spade, ensuring the plant's root ball remains intact. Carefully work the spade under the root ball to lift the plant from its original location.
From Pot: Water the shaggy leaf fig plant thoroughly to help loosen the soil. Gently tip the pot on its side and tap or squeeze the sides to release the plant. Carefully slide the plant out, holding onto the base of the stem rather than pulling on the foliage.
From Seedling Tray: Water the seedlings to ensure the soil is moist. Use a garden trowel to gently lift each seedling out, taking care to keep as much soil attached to the roots as possible.
